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Tottenham, England and Homerton, England?

Greater Anglia operates a train from Tottenham Hale to Hackney Downs hourly. Tickets cost £4–8 and the journey takes 6 min. Two other operators also service this route. Alternatively, Go Ahead London operates a bus from Selborne Walk to Glyn Road every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£1–35 and the journey takes 52 min. Replacement Service also services this route 6 times a week.
